The successful candidate must be a dynamic clinician with a strong clinical background and ability to work well with teams. The primary role of the School Behavior Intervention Specialist is to provide consultation and behavioral support to students and classroom teams. Responsibilities : Responsible for completing going functional analysis and as necessary the development of behavior intervention plans. Model the implementation of behavior intervention plans, support the implementation of the plans, and train staff as needed. Become SCIP-R trained, as well as become a SCIP-R trainer Position involves facilitating staff and family training and special projects as needed.
